    Understanding Fractions and Percentages

    Before diving into the calculation, let's quickly refresh our understanding of fractions and percentages. A fraction represents a part of a whole, expressed as a ratio of two numbers (numerator and denominator). A percentage, on the other hand, represents a fraction of 100. The term "percent" literally means "out of 100."

    Converting 4/7 to a Percentage: Step-by-Step

    Here's how to convert the fraction 4/7 into a percentage:

    1. Divide the numerator by the denominator: This is the core of the conversion. Divide 4 by 7: 4 ÷ 7 ≈ 0.5714

    2. Multiply the result by 100: This step transforms the decimal value into a percentage. Multiply 0.5714 by 100: 0.5714 x 100 = 57.14

    3. Add the percentage symbol (%): This indicates that the value represents a percentage. Therefore, 4/7 is approximately 57.14%.

    Therefore, 4/7 as a percentage is approximately 57.14%.

    Rounding and Accuracy

    It's important to note that the result (57.14%) is an approximation. The decimal representation of 4/7 is a non-terminating decimal, meaning it goes on infinitely. Depending on the context, you might need to round the percentage to a specific number of decimal places. For most practical purposes, rounding to two decimal places (57.14%) is sufficient.
